NWS Memphis warns that 6 inches of moving water can knock you down
The National Weather Service in Memphis warned that even shallow floodwater can be dangerous, saying it only takes 6 inches of moving water to knock a person off their feet.
The agency said water levels and the speed of flow can change quickly and urged people to get to higher ground. It advised against driving or walking into floodwater.
The NWS told residents to stay informed by monitoring local radio and television for updates and directed people to weather.gov/safety/flood for more information.
